From d36fd415b4351f571b701e416aa97f0d16bd1246 Mon Sep 17 00:00:00 2001 From: mt Date: Fri, 22 May 2009 19:51:36 +0000 Subject: [PATCH] -Remove some unnecessary defines from rm.c. -Modify code related to the renamed rm.[c/h] instead of rm2wav.[c/h]. -Remove struct cook_extradata from rm.c as it is not used. git-svn-id: svn://svn.rockbox.org/rockbox/trunk@21041 a1c6a512-1295-4272-9138-f99709370657 --- apps/codecs/libcook/Makefile.test | 2 +- apps/codecs/libcook/cook.h | 2 +- apps/codecs/libcook/main.c | 2 +- apps/codecs/libcook/rm.c | 21 +-------------------- apps/codecs/libcook/rm.h | 4 ++-- 5 files changed, 6 insertions(+), 25 deletions(-) diff --git a/apps/codecs/libcook/Makefile.test b/apps/codecs/libcook/Makefile.test index d5d91708f..a12554482 100644 --- a/apps/codecs/libcook/Makefile.test +++ b/apps/codecs/libcook/Makefile.test @@ -1,5 +1,5 @@ CFLAGS = -Wall -O3 -OBJS = main.o bitstream.o cook.o rm2wav.o +OBJS = main.o bitstream.o cook.o rm.o cooktest: $(OBJS) gcc -o cooktest $(OBJS) diff --git a/apps/codecs/libcook/cook.h b/apps/codecs/libcook/cook.h index da3c03f1d..f5da639eb 100644 --- a/apps/codecs/libcook/cook.h +++ b/apps/codecs/libcook/cook.h @@ -24,7 +24,7 @@ #include #include "bitstream.h" -#include "rm2wav.h" +#include "rm.h" #include "cookdata_fixpoint.h" typedef struct { diff --git a/apps/codecs/libcook/main.c b/apps/codecs/libcook/main.c index c13e74a20..b0b2829f2 100644 --- a/apps/codecs/libcook/main.c +++ b/apps/codecs/libcook/main.c @@ -25,7 +25,7 @@ #include #include -#include "rm2wav.h" +#include "rm.h" #include "cook.h" //#define DUMP_RAW_FRAMES diff --git a/apps/codecs/libcook/rm.c b/apps/codecs/libcook/rm.c index f2e9635bf..92b642846 100644 --- a/apps/codecs/libcook/rm.c +++ b/apps/codecs/libcook/rm.c @@ -27,11 +27,7 @@ #include #include -#include "rm2wav.h" - -#define MAX_PATH 260 -#define PKT_HEADER_SIZE 12 -#define RAW_AUDIO_DATA packet_length-PKT_HEADER_SIZE +#include "rm.h" #if 0 @@ -40,23 +36,8 @@ #else #define DEBUGF(...) #endif - -/* ASF codec IDs */ -#define CODEC_ID_WMAV1 0x160 -#define CODEC_ID_WMAV2 0x161 /* Some Rockbox-like functions (these should be implemented in metadata_common.[ch] */ -struct cook_extradata { - uint32_t cook_version; - uint16_t samples_pf_pc; /* samples per frame per channel */ - uint16_t nb_subbands; /* number of subbands in the frequency domain */ - - /* extra 8 bytes for stereo data */ - uint32_t unused; - uint16_t js_subband_start; /* joint stereo subband start */ - uint16_t js_vlc_bits; -}; - static int read_uint8(int fd, uint8_t* buf) { unsigned char tmp[1]; diff --git a/apps/codecs/libcook/rm.h b/apps/codecs/libcook/rm.h index f36145fc1..8e2ebe8a1 100644 --- a/apps/codecs/libcook/rm.h +++ b/apps/codecs/libcook/rm.h @@ -18,8 +18,8 @@ * KIND, either express or implied. * ****************************************************************************/ -#ifndef _RM2WAV_H -#define _RM2WAV_H +#ifndef _RM_H +#define _RM_H #include #include -- 2.11.4.GIT